
Local businesses in Ramsey are being offered a new channel to reach their clientele more effectively. The city's publication, The Ramsey Resident, is rolling out discounted advertising opportunities designed to amplify local commerce. In a social media post, the City of Ramsey announced this initiative, which mails over 12,000 copies of the publication six times a year not only to residences but also to other businesses, potentially increasing the local impact of advertising.
Furthermore, in a bid to attract consistent advertising partners, the city has revealed an appealing financial incentive. "We've lowered advertising rates per issue, plus there is now a 10% discount on six consecutive ad placements," the City of Ramsey shared on Facebook. It's a strategic move, one that not only aims to support the local economy but also encourages a steady influx of content, for an already established readership.
Simplicity seems to be at the heart of this advertising opportunity, dispelling any complexities frequently associated with ad placement. By including ad creation as part of their services, the City takes on the burden, potentially appealing to business owners who may lack the time or resources to craft their own advertisements. Yet, for those with a specific vision, submissions of self-created ads are still an accepted practice. As detailed in the City's social media post, rates include ad creation by City staff, or businesses can submit their own ad.
